NOAA said the heatwave would break at 5pm on Thursday, so I knew we were in for some wind and it was chaotic. I was happy when I made a couple of good tacks. It works when you keep the mast across the board and away from your body and pause just before changing sides.
NOAA called for winds 23 to 26 with gusts to 30 Friday and they turned out to be right. Yesterday I used the Flipper 14.4; my first run was powered and the board very lively. Today I thought I’d try the FS 13 again (it’s actually larger than the Flipper 14.4). It spun out on me once and then I thought, well, am I sailing the way Jason trained me? Uh, maybe not. So I worked on keeping my back knee bent and I never spun out again, even when I was dragging a salad’s worth of weed!
